Feldbaush, Clarabelle Strait. WAADKITA QCLUB Gimme a job-will ya-huh ? Emily Post forbids such a procedure and of course the student didn't get it when seeking it in that manner. After complaining of the cruelty of the cold world to his student pals, it was decided to really find out just how to get this job. Under the direction of Bliss Klinerva Kies, the Wvaa-Kita club was formed last year. Vocations from ditch digging to engineering were discussed. This year the members discussed parliamentary law, college entrances, etiquette and customs of different countries. lliss Genevieve Buck was faculty advisor. HOUSEHOLD ARTS The Household Arts club is made up of industrious young people striving earn- estly to become model young housewives. Every second and fourth Thursday, they start out to take in a style show, to learn the latest fashions, or to visit a bread company to learn the secrets of making bread. They study the intricacies of pie- making in order to make the kind mother used to bake . They have talks on mono- gram embroidery so that no guests will be able to walk off with their towels. They learn to bake biscuits, not the kind that are the reason why men leave home. Last year, the society became affiliated with the National Home Economics Asso- ciation, so now they get the latest wrinkles in handkerchiefs and other accessories. Bliss Lotta Lower, who directs the girls of Central in darning stockings, sewing seams, and such useful arts, is advisor.
